diff --git a/packages/aview/asciiview.patch b/packages/aview/asciiview.patch new file mode 100644 index 000000000..3830c2de1 --- /dev/null +++ b/packages/aview/asciiview.patch @@ -0,0 +1,40 @@ +--- ./asciiview.orig 2022-03-11 08:12:07.366680669 +0100 ++++ ./asciiview 2022-03-11 08:12:28.626681326 +0100 +@@ -3,11 +3,11 @@ + clear() + { + kill $! 2>/dev/null +- rm -f /tmp/aview$$.pgm 2>/dev/null ++ rm -f @TERMUX_PREFIX@/tmp/aview$$.pgm 2>/dev/null + } + myconvert() + { +- if anytopnm $1 >/tmp/aview$$.pgm 2>/dev/null ; then ++ if anytopnm $1 >@TERMUX_PREFIX@/tmp/aview$$.pgm 2>/dev/null ; then + exit + elif convert -colorspace gray $1 pgm:- 2>/dev/null ; then + exit +@@ -51,8 +51,8 @@ + esac + done + trap clear 0 +-mkfifo /tmp/aview$$.pgm +-outfile=/tmp/aview$$.pgm ++mkfifo @TERMUX_PREFIX@/tmp/aview$$.pgm ++outfile=@TERMUX_PREFIX@/tmp/aview$$.pgm + for name in $filenames ; do + if test -r $name ; then + case $name in +@@ -61,10 +61,10 @@ + aaflip $options $name + ;; + *) +- myconvert $name >/tmp/aview$$.pgm & ++ myconvert $name >@TERMUX_PREFIX@/tmp/aview$$.pgm & + pid=$! + PATH="$PATH:." +- aview $options /tmp/aview$$.pgm ++ aview $options @TERMUX_PREFIX@/tmp/aview$$.pgm + kill $pid 2>/dev/null + esac + else diff --git a/packages/aview/build.sh b/packages/aview/build.sh index 01795b3a5..59937b457 100644 --- a/packages/aview/build.sh +++ b/packages/aview/build.sh @@ -3,6 +3,7 @@ TERMUX_PKG_DESCRIPTION="High quality ascii-art image browser and animation playe TERMUX_PKG_LICENSE="GPL-2.0" TERMUX_PKG_MAINTAINER="@termux" TERMUX_PKG_VERSION=1.3.0rc1 +TERMUX_PKG_REVISION=1 TERMUX_PKG_SRCURL=https://downloads.sourceforge.net/aa-project/aview/aview-${TERMUX_PKG_VERSION}.tar.gz TERMUX_PKG_SHA256=42d61c4194e8b9b69a881fdde698c83cb27d7eda59e08b300e73aaa34474ec99 TERMUX_PKG_DEPENDS="aalib"